在互联网时代,响应式网页设计成为了网页开发的重要趋势。它能够确保网页在不同设备上都能展现出最佳的用户体验。JSP(Java Server Pages)和Bootstrap框架是两个非常流行的工具,可以帮助开发者轻松构建响应式网页。本文将详细介绍如何掌握JSP与Bootstrap框架,并带你一步步打造出美观且实用的响应式网页。
JSP简介
什么是JSP?
JSP是一种动态网页技术,它允许开发者在HTML页面中嵌入Java代码。当用户请求一个JSP页面时,服务器会将其转换为HTML页面,然后发送给用户。这使得JSP成为创建动态网页的理想选择。
JSP的优势
- 跨平台性:JSP基于Java技术,因此可以在任何支持Java的服务器上运行。
- 易用性:JSP语法简单,易于学习和使用。
- 动态内容:JSP可以与数据库和其他后端系统进行交互,从而实现动态内容生成。
Bootstrap框架简介
什么是Bootstrap?
Bootstrap是一个流行的前端框架,它提供了许多预先定义的样式和组件,可以快速构建响应式网页。Bootstrap利用CSS和HTML来创建一个布局,使得网页在不同设备上都能保持一致的外观和功能。
Bootstrap的优势
- 响应式设计:Bootstrap内置了响应式网格系统,可以轻松适应不同屏幕尺寸。
- 组件丰富:Bootstrap提供了大量的UI组件,如按钮、表单、导航栏等,方便快速开发。
- 简洁易用:Bootstrap的代码结构清晰,易于学习和使用。
JSP与Bootstrap的结合
步骤一:创建JSP项目
- 安装Java开发工具包(JDK):首先,确保你的电脑上安装了JDK。
- 安装IDE:推荐使用IntelliJ IDEA或Eclipse等IDE来开发JSP项目。
- 创建项目:在IDE中创建一个新的Java Web项目。
步骤二:引入Bootstrap
- 下载Bootstrap:从Bootstrap官网下载最新版本的Bootstrap。
- 引入CSS和JavaScript:将Bootstrap的CSS和JavaScript文件添加到JSP页面的
<head>部分。
<link rel="stylesheet" href="path/to/bootstrap.min.css">
<script src="path/to/jquery.min.js"></script>
<script src="path/to/bootstrap.min.js"></script>
步骤三:使用Bootstrap构建响应式布局
- 使用栅格系统:Bootstrap的栅格系统可以快速创建响应式布局。
- 使用组件:Bootstrap提供了丰富的UI组件,如按钮、表单、导航栏等。
<div class="container">
<div class="row">
<div class="col-md-6">
<!-- 内容 -->
</div>
<div class="col-md-6">
<!-- 内容 -->
</div>
</div>
</div>
步骤四:测试和部署
- 测试:在本地环境中测试你的JSP页面,确保其在不同设备上都能正常显示。
- 部署:将你的JSP项目部署到服务器上,以便用户可以访问。
总结
掌握JSP与Bootstrap框架,可以帮助开发者快速构建美观且实用的响应式网页。通过本文的介绍,相信你已经对如何结合这两个工具有了更深入的了解。接下来,不妨动手实践,将所学知识应用到实际项目中吧!
